Brewers aim for eighth straight win vs. Padres
Aug 13, 2008 - 10:10 AM Milwaukee (69-51) at San Diego (46-73) 10:05 p.m. EDTSAN DIEGO (Ticker) -- The Milwaukee Brewers will be in search of their eighth consecutive win Wednesday when they visit the San Diego Padres.
The Brewers are on a mission to reach the postseason for the first time since 1982 and have shown it over the last seven contests as they have outscored their opponents, 42-11.
The road has also become an advantage of late, as Tuesday's 5-2 victory gave Milwaukee its 12th win in the last 15 games away from Miller Park.
Prince Fielder hit a three-run homer and Jeff Suppan pitched eight strong innings in the series opener. Fielder has seven blasts in his last 13 games, picking up the slack for Ryan Braun, who has missed the last three games due to lower back tightness.
CC Sabathia (12-8, 3.11 ERA) will get the call for the Brewers, looking to post a second consecutive shutout. The hefty lefthander is 6-0 with a 1.58 ERA in seven starts since moving over to the National League on July 7.
Sabathia is already tied for the NL lead in complete games with four - matching teammate Ben Sheets.
The Padres will counter with rookie Josh Banks (3-4, 3.77). The 26-year-old righthander has not factored in the decision in either of his last two outings despite allowing four earned runs in 12 combined frames.
